js中如何得到循环中的某一个id ,求指教
<spanid="sup_<?phpecho$row['id'];?>>"><?phpecho$row['support'];?></span>以上是问题...
<span id="sup_<?php echo $row['id'];?>>"><?php echo $row['support'];?></span> 以上是问题
展开
5个回答
展开全部
这个id是由你的php产生的,得到这个id也是可以由你的php程序得到,然后php赋值给js就行了。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
js方法给个参数传id 然后拼 id 然后就取到了
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
可以c:forEach中将生成的div id写到一个js的数组中,之后在页面用js访问这个数组即可
或者用生成的div的别的特征来选到这个div再获取他的id,比如class属性。可以让生成的div使用同已前缀或者后缀的来区分于其他div。
如果生成的div的id是可以在c:forEach中控制的,可以用例如myDiv_1,myDiv_2这样的来定义,然后在页面用JS按照约定直接getElementById("myDiv_" + i);获取到。
或者用生成的div的别的特征来选到这个div再获取他的id,比如class属性。可以让生成的div使用同已前缀或者后缀的来区分于其他div。
如果生成的div的id是可以在c:forEach中控制的,可以用例如myDiv_1,myDiv_2这样的来定义,然后在页面用JS按照约定直接getElementById("myDiv_" + i);获取到。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询